Output fd22e09e7abe83c07da170d5836da2dc820f153c2aa90ee67db0a7a004cd4346:0

value
8013431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e84506c60a1454ba5bd89005102e622859b9e3bc OP_EQUAL
address
3Ns9P6DzhFjNpvjGuW4gcm6pc4QzFohpyx
transaction
fd22e09e7abe83c07da170d5836da2dc820f153c2aa90ee67db0a7a004cd4346
confirmations
165215
spent
true